ACARS
 
I have worked on installing the latest ACARS system in my airline and the amount of information that one can get from ACARS is mind boggling. In fact I would dare to say that is as good as FDR , but obviously lacks the CVR capability of recording voice.

ACARS works with VHF or SATCOM , there is also a HF data solution but it is not common and only few airlines use it.

As far as the AF A330 is concerned , I have no doubt that they had SATCOM as the postion of the A/C over the ocean was away from any ground base recivers . hence MCC or Operation Control could get all the messages from the stricken aircraft.

One thing that remains to be seen is how Air France has selected to operate the ACARS on this route. Transmissions using SATCOM are expensive, many airlines are selctive in the amount and the frequency of information that is transmitted by ACARS using SATCOM. Some configure the system to collect all the data and when they reach a VHF station , it dumps all that data to base using the much cheaper rate.

A very good question was raised about the G force . YES , ACARS can send this information as well and it will be quite helpfull in the crash analysis. Whether the G force was recieved by Air France or not is not clear.

ACRAS is the primary tool for Aircraft Tracking with many airlines operations control centers. However , again it depends on how the airline has configured the system. Obviousley it is a waste of money to send postion fix every five minutes (specially under SATCOM) , neverthanless ACARS is second best flight tracking system after Radars with an added advantage that a Radar has certain range while ACARS is not necessarily bound by range limitation.

For you Airbus 330-200 drivers out there (or anyone else who actually flies for a living at the higher flight levels)....

FL 350 and still heavy with weight of 8 hrs of fuel plus reserves remaining for the trip.

Autopilot disconnect (for whatever reason, the ACARS says this was the first event) , now hand flying in Alternate Law. No overbank or (my understanding) buffet protections. Moderate, or possibly severe turbulence in the mix if that's what kicked off the Autopilot in the first place due to pitch or roll overlimits. Now your prime consideratoin is to keep the aircraft within the aerodynamic buffet boundaries.

Have any of you hand-flown an Airbus (or other aircraft heavy with fuel) at those flight levels even in smooth air? What about in rough air and may have to maneuver...or outside forces are doing the maneuvering/airspeed fluxuations for you and you're fighting to stay withing the (small at FL350) flying envelope/Q-corner?

The problem with > moderate turbulence when you're high and heavy isn't about shearing off parts of the aircraft that in turn cause it to come down, it's about being able to keep it flying especially if the Autopilot gives up due to conditions exceeding it's capability to keep up with changes of axis/and or airspeed and suddenly hands control over directly to the pilots, where that pilot may have little or no experience controlling his wallowing aircraft in that high-altitude, small margin for error realm of fight on a good day, let alone a dark and stormy night.

Perfectly good airplanes have succumbed to the Laws of Aerodynamics with no faults, structural failures before the fact, lightning strikes, b-word events, etc. etc. etc. in the mix. Just because in normal conditions we don't run up against the boundaries of those Laws doesn't mean they disappeared...they're still there waiting to bite. And we are paid NOT to run up against those boundaries and avoid situations where we might, and this is what we routinely do as professionals.

Take a jet aircraft and put it high, heavy, and run it through rough enough air and the Laws of Aerodynamics are waiting. I assume they still teach these things for those that haven't experienced it. They really aren't kidding.

It seems many people here are looking at the weather as a probable cause.

I have flown the A340 (but not A330) for many years in similar tropical weather on the other side of the world , Africa , Far East and India where the same weather pattern exists.

Towering CB's , Massive CAT's , rain and precipitation of huge magnitudes are quite common. No pilot in his right frame of mind will attempt to penetrate the worst of such weather and in this day and age , the pilot has plenty of information and warning to prevent him from going through such weather.

If , and I say a BIG IF , weather is considered as a major factor , then surely there must have been a failure in the cockpit mainly the weather radar, that sent the crew into a very active cell. OR , the radar failed to pick up these activities !!!!

Our old A 340's ( no more flying) had a problem with weather radars. If I can remember rightly , we had problems with the shallow band of vertical coverage of the radar. It could not pick up the significant weather when it was tilted beyond certain degrees , up or down. Apparently it was a software issue , which was supposed to be fixed in the newer generations of A340 and A330.

Knutsford 4th Jun 2009 10:36

The "failure" of the Captains TAT probe would cause a double ADR fault.

The result of this is the disconnection of the autopilot and a reversion to Alternate (2) Law.

This was quoted in an earlier post as the first two symptoms transmitted via ACARS.

As I understand it, the health of the said TAT probe is not monitored, so this would not be evident.
